Relative molecular mass of an element or a compound is the number of times one _____ of the substance is heavier than 1/12 of the mass of an atom of carbon
(Atom/ion/molecule)

relative molecular mass of an element /compound is the number of times one molecule of a substance is heavier than minus -1 /12 that the mass of an atom of carbon(C12)
